¿Qué Pasó en México? Muerte del Mencho - What Happened in Mexico? The Death of El Mencho
Use Left/Right to seek, Home/End to jump to start or end. Hold shift to jump forward or backward.
After many of you reached out to ask if we were safe, we decided to dedicate this episode to explaining what really happened during the recent violence in states like Jalisco, Colima, and Michoacán. We break down the timeline of events—from the military operation in Tapalpa to the 250+ road blockades, airport disruptions, burned businesses (including dozens of Oxxos), and the wave of misinformation spreading on social media. We also share our honest thoughts about safety in Mexico, what this means for travelers and our immersion retreats, and reflect on the bigger political picture—including corruption, organized crime, and whether this moment could represent real change. If you’ve seen the headlines and felt unsure about visiting Mexico, this episode will give you context, clarity, and our personal perspective from living here.
Key Takeaways:
- What actually happened during and after the operation against El Mencho—and how it impacted daily life across Mexico.
- Why most tourists are not the target in these conflicts, and what travelers should realistically consider.
- A deeper look at organized crime, government response, and whether this event signals hope or just another chapter in a complex system.
